r e a: NATIVE
For over three decades, r e a, a descendant of the Gamilaraay, Wailwan and Biripi peoples, has worked at the forefront of Australian Indigenous new media theory and practice in Australia and internationally.
r e a: NATIVE comprises two interrelated installations delving into the historical and colonial archive. In the first room is a remastered iteration of r e a’s Native, 2013, a site-responsive sound and neon installation first developed as part of their Indigenous Artist Residency at the Blacktown Arts Centre in 2013. In the second gallery, Native (yugal/song), 2024, incorporates video and motion sensors that enable viewers to use their bodies to experience sound and to perceive it in a visual form. The conceptual and physical touchstone of both installations is the Blacktown Native Institute, founded in Parramatta in 1815 and relocated to Blacktown in 1823, one of the first sites in Australia where Aboriginal children were removed from their parents and institutionalised.
r e a: NATIVE coincides with ISEA2024 (21 - 29 June) which brings together artists, scientists and scholars from around the world to explore the intersection of art, science and technology. This year’s conference theme, Everywhen, explores the human perception of space and time. This word describes the notion that past, present and future are co-habiting in any given location. Projection 3: Chanelling Dulcie's Piano
Vanessa Tomlinson (CARI), Jesse Budel, Greg Harm, Tangible Media
Using a personally significant, surplus-to-needs piano, this work translates the normally inaudible sounds of the flooding Murray-Darling river system at a billabong in Wilcannia, into a realtime composition; building a new musical language for the now decaying piano; using the river to teach the piano to sing.
